TORONTO-BASED ARTIST KATIE PRETTI’S DIZZYING EXHIBIT AT NEUBACHER SHOR
Story by Nina Cherry
Images provided by Neubacher Shor Contemporary
We’ve fallen head over heels for Katie Pretti’s latest body-of-work. The 14 pieces that make up Swoon were inspired by Pretti’s recent experiences traveling and working around the world; each of them capturing the whirlwind of being somewhere unfamiliar: the dizzying sensations created by new colours, smells, sounds and sights. Just staring into the canvas, the floor begins to slip out from under your feet.
Swoon
Neubacher Shor Contemporary gallery (5 Brock Avenue, Toronto)
Oct 11 – Nov 24, 2012
